Understanding the Government's Response
The government has intensified its scrutiny of social media platforms, particularly Meta, following alarming reports of child sexual abuse imagery being promoted through paid advertisements on Instagram. This decisive action underscores growing concerns about safety on digital platforms, especially in regions like Southeast Asia, where the prevalence of social media is surging.
Context and Implications
In a world where social media is integral to communication and marketing, the government’s notice to Meta serves as a crucial reminder of the responsibilities tech companies hold. The alarming nature of the content associated with Instagram ads raises questions about the effectiveness of Meta’s content moderation systems. Recent figures show that over 160 million users in Indonesia alone rely on Instagram for both personal and business purposes, making it essential for the platform to prioritize user safety.
Insights into Regulatory Trends
The Southeast Asian market is witnessing a shift towards more stringent regulations for digital platforms. Governments are recognizing their duty to protect vulnerable users, particularly children, from harmful content. This reaction is part of a broader trend observed in ASEAN countries, where authorities are pushing for enhanced regulatory frameworks to govern online spaces.
Potential Impact on Meta
The repercussions of this governmental notice could be significant for Meta. Apart from tarnishing its reputation, failure to address these concerns could lead to stricter regulations, affecting how it operates in lucrative markets like Jakarta and Surabaya. The Indonesian government is expected to follow up with specific guidelines to bolster protections against child exploitation.
